Output 4cfb2d004a30350873dcc46643d7f79e27216e46e25eb2654c0f582e0c8ae543:21

value
16390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a750c71cec43f62e9b3136491c183337f8640a OP_EQUAL
address
3Bxg3KHpZeuDVwi7iFo2R1JABArycDB9V2
transaction
4cfb2d004a30350873dcc46643d7f79e27216e46e25eb2654c0f582e0c8ae543
confirmations
166509
spent
true